Ok well, for a start, keep your cat indoors for at least a full 7 days. That way, she will have adapted to the idea that she lives there, and she will have a keen sense of the daily odors. Dont leave him/her alone for long hours because the cat could end up damaging itself and/or the house (the cat may get frightened if alone at first). If it had any toys, or blanket that it slept on when you got him/her, ask if you could have it to bring home with you (it is easier for the cat to adjust to new surroundings if it has a familiar item to sleep or be with).
